Suicide Bomber Kills Six, Injures 15 in Borno

A devastating suicide attack occurred at a wedding gathering in Marrarraban Gwoza, Borno State, claiming the lives of 6 civilians and injuring 15 others. The bomber, a young woman in her early twenties, detonated her explosive device in the midst of the gathering, causing chaos and destruction.

According to intelligence sources, the victims were returning from a wedding celebration when the attack occurred near a busy motor park. Emergency services promptly responded to the scene, rescuing the injured and transporting them to hospitals in Gwoza.

Medical personnel confirmed that at least 6 people were killed, while 15 others sustained injuries in the attack. The Borno State Commissioner of Police, Yusuf Lawal, has also confirmed the incident.

The attack took place at T Junction in Marrarraban Gwoza, a bustling area in the state. The suicide bomber, a female in her early twenties, targeted the social gathering, causing widespread destruction and loss of life.

According to a survivor, the first bomber was carrying a baby on her back when she stormed the venue and detonated the IED.

The wedding was held on Saturday at Tashan Mararaba near the Fire Service in Gwoza town.

The bomber identified as a young mother in her twenties pretended to be a guest at the wedding.

While trying to bury the dead persons, another bomber disguised as a mourner detonated an IED at the burial ground, killing one person.

The military has, as a result of the explosions, declared a curfew in Gwoza with immediate effect.

Security agencies are also yet to comment on the incident as of now.

Attempts to speak with the spokespersons of North-East Joint Taskforce Operations Hadin Kai and that of the 7 Division and Sector One OPHK have not been successful as they didn’t pick up their calls.
